What is a part time intake?

Part time intake positions are roles in which employees are responsible for collecting and recording information from clients or customers, typically in settings such as healthcare, legal, or social services. These staff members usually serve as the first point of contact, gathering essential details to initiate services or processes. Working part time means they have a reduced or flexible schedule, making the role suitable for those seeking fewer hours or balancing other commitments. Strong organizational, communication, and data entry skills are essential for success in this position.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time intake specialist?

To thrive as a Part-Time Intake Specialist, you generally need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and experience in customer service or healthcare administration,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with electronic health records (EHR) systems, data entry software, and scheduling tools is typically expected. Excellent communication, active listening, and empathy help build rapport with clients and ensure accurate information gathering. These skills are crucial for efficiently processing intakes, supporting team workflow, and providing a positive first impression for clients or patients.

What are some common challenges faced by part time intake specialists, and how can they be managed effectively?

Part-time intake specialists often face challenges such as managing a high volume of client inquiries within limited working hours and ensuring thorough documentation for each case. Balancing multiple priorities while maintaining accuracy and empathy can be demanding. Effective time management, clear communication with team members, and familiarity with the organization's intake procedures can help mitigate these challenges. Many organizations provide training and digital tools to streamline the process, making it easier for part-time staff to stay organized and deliver quality service.

What is the difference between Part Time Intake vs Part Time Receptionist?

AspectPart Time IntakePart Time Receptionist
Primary RoleGathering patient or client information, scheduling appointments, initial screeningGreeting visitors, answering phones, managing front desk
Required SkillsCommunication, data entry, basic medical or client knowledgeCustomer service, organization, communication
Work EnvironmentHealthcare facilities, clinics, officesReception areas, offices, front desk
Common CertificationsNone required or medical-related certificationsNone required, customer service experience

Part Time Intake roles focus on initial client or patient screening and data collection, often in healthcare settings, while Part Time Receptionist positions involve greeting visitors and managing front desk duties. Both roles require strong communication skills but differ in their primary responsibilities and work environment.
